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) :

The countries with the highest volumes of consumption in 2023 were Germany, Italy and Spain, together accounting for 43% of total consumption. Poland, France, Slovakia, the Czech Republic, Romania, the Netherlands, Belgium, Portugal, Austria and Sweden l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 48%.
The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2022 were the Czech Republic, Germany and Italy, with a combined 35% share of total production. Poland, Slovakia, Spain, Romania, France, Austria, the Netherlands, Portugal and Slovenia l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 54%.
In value terms, Germany remains the largest automotive lighting supplier in the European Union, comprising 30%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was held by the Czech Republic, with a 15% share of total exports. It was followed by Slovakia, with a 9.5% share.
In value terms, Germany constitutes the largest market for imported automotive lighting in the European Union, comprising 40% of total imports. The second position in the ranking was held by Spain, with a 7.3% share of total imports. It was followed by France, with a 7.1% share.
In 2022, the export price in the European Union amounted to $27 per unit, falling by -9% against the previous year.
The import price in the European Union stood at $23 per unit in 2022, standing approx. at the previous year.
